Relating to the establishment of a grant program to support the disposition of deceased paupers' bodies.
HB 5389 establishes a state grant program to help counties cover the costs of disposing of bodies for people who die without funds for burial (referred to as "deceased paupers" in the bill). The Health and Human Services Commission will administer the program, using funds from a dedicated account (financed by state appropriations, donations, and interest) to provide grants for both the actual disposal costs and administrative expenses related to body disposition. Counties receiving grants must use funds strictly for these purposes, and the program takes effect September 1, 2025.
